Abstract
The finding that with a reasonable effort a layer thickness and/or refractive index variation may be acquired which realizes different internal optical path lengths for impinging radiation whereby fluctuation of spectral sensitivity of the photodetector is reduced is used to provide image sensors with a less fluctuating spectral sensitivity with respect to different wavelengths, or photodetectors with a small fluctuation of the spectral sensitivity from photodetector to photodetector with respect to defined wavelengths, with a reasonable effort.
